1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2026-02-15 04:11:53 -08:00
Commit graph

6193 commits

Author SHA1 Message Date
Richard M. Stallman
fd80e3bbba (mark_object): Add no-op cast. 1994-03-06 22:07:19 +00:00
Richard M. Stallman
a1ed3ba654 (edebug-skip-whitespace): Only \n, not \r, ends a comment. 1994-03-06 21:05:30 +00:00
Richard M. Stallman
9125da08de (error): Use doprnt. Make buffer larger as necessary. 1994-03-06 20:39:52 +00:00
Richard M. Stallman
288f95bd03 (backquote-listify): Renamed from bq-listify.
(backquote-process): Renamed from bq-process.
(backquote-list*-function): Renamed from list*-function.
(backquote-list*-macro): Renamed from list*-macro.
(backquote-list*): Renamed from list*.
1994-03-06 19:43:23 +00:00
Richard M. Stallman
41ea659a7f Complete rewrite by Sladkey. 1994-03-06 19:39:10 +00:00
Richard M. Stallman
0dba5606aa Comment changes. 1994-03-06 19:00:21 +00:00
Richard M. Stallman
34628a901f (operate_on_word): Don't move point; store in *NEWPOINT.
(Fupcase_word, Fdowncase_word, Fcapitalize_word):
Set point after changing case.  Rename opoint to beg.
1994-03-06 18:54:21 +00:00
Richard M. Stallman
d6eac7d468 Initial revision 1994-03-06 03:27:00 +00:00
Richard M. Stallman
1bd5084056 (c++-font-lock-keywords-1, c++-font-lock-keywords-2): New variables.
(c++-font-lock-keywords): Use c++-font-lock-keywords-1.
1994-03-05 23:32:27 +00:00
Richard M. Stallman
54b2aa5c65 (jka-compr-insert-file-contents): Handle 5th arg. 1994-03-05 23:28:35 +00:00
Richard M. Stallman
b3bbaa663d (byte-compile-track-mouse): Handle >1 body form.
Generate code that binds track-mouse.
1994-03-05 23:27:51 +00:00
Richard M. Stallman
846d69ac63 (ARRAY_MARK_FLAG): Define here. 1994-03-05 23:26:52 +00:00
Richard M. Stallman
e3515d10e7 Clean up indentation and whitespace. 1994-03-05 21:53:42 +00:00
Richard M. Stallman
902a54b2c7 (main): Change delimiter from "^L" to "^_^L".
Allow for text following "BABYL OPTIONS:".
Add --help option.  Use argv[0] in error messages.
1994-03-05 21:49:26 +00:00
Richard M. Stallman
1518a9eb45 (main) [HAVE_SYSVIPC]: Make msgp->mtext longer if necessary.
On HPUX, error if it's more than 512 chars.
1994-03-05 21:42:57 +00:00
Richard M. Stallman
0bc439a076 Include config.h, lisp.h, buffer.h, process.h, commands.h, errno.h and file.h.
(write_to_vms_process): Change =- to -=.
(create_process): Set status field instead of obsolete flags field.
(child_sig): Likewise.
1994-03-05 21:38:34 +00:00
Richard M. Stallman
3f872b675a (ARRAY_MARK_FLAG): Definition moved to lisp.h. 1994-03-05 20:39:07 +00:00
Richard M. Stallman
829d872be9 (shut_down_emacs): Set Vrun_hooks to nil. 1994-03-05 20:38:30 +00:00
Richard M. Stallman
012d4cdc7f (Fdo_auto_save): Doc fix. 1994-03-05 20:36:38 +00:00
Richard M. Stallman
88ce066e29 (command_loop_1, read_key_sequence, Fcommand_execute):
Don't call Vrun_hooks if it is nil.
1994-03-05 20:35:52 +00:00
Richard M. Stallman
92d3b06efb (read_minibuf): Don't call Vrun_hooks if it is nil. 1994-03-05 20:35:13 +00:00
Richard M. Stallman
9fed2b1852 (save_excursion_restore): Don't call Vrun_hooks if nil. 1994-03-05 20:32:35 +00:00
Richard M. Stallman
fd186f07f1 (Fkill_buffer, Fkill_all_local_variables):
Don't call Vrun_hooks if it is nil.
1994-03-05 20:31:10 +00:00
Karl Heuer
8746da9580 (command_loop_1): Fix misplaced assignment of last_point_position. 1994-03-05 03:58:45 +00:00
Karl Heuer
c47fae76cd (rmail-message-filter): Doc fix. 1994-03-04 23:08:31 +00:00
Karl Heuer
972a693aa5 *** empty log message *** 1994-03-04 22:26:03 +00:00
Karl Heuer
1a2f2d332e (isnan): New macro.
(float_arith_driver): min and max yield NaN if any argument is a NaN.
1994-03-04 21:21:08 +00:00
Fred Pierresteguy
cffa74ea6c (update_one_frame_psheets): Call EmacsFrameSetCharSize to
force the paned widget to resize to the right value.
        (xmenu_show): No need to check a second time whether the mouse has
        moved to another menu bar item. This slows down execution.
1994-03-04 09:30:58 +00:00
Fred Pierresteguy
57aa60d8f1 (EmacsFrameSetCharSize): Don't call XtMakeResizeRequest. Use XtVaSetValues for
geometry management.
1994-03-04 09:09:49 +00:00
Roland McGrath
6f3e8e346c [USE_X_TOOLKIT] (xmenu_show): Pass display to XtWindowToWidget. 1994-03-04 07:52:34 +00:00
Roland McGrath
31efa7c9f6 (compile-goto-error): Push the mark before calling next-error. 1994-03-04 06:11:51 +00:00
Richard M. Stallman
9239c6c1ee (skip_chars): Treat `-' as alias for space, if syntaxp. 1994-03-04 04:42:04 +00:00
Richard M. Stallman
acc8cdd212 (system-key-alist): Fix the code value for `remove'. 1994-03-04 04:38:06 +00:00
Richard M. Stallman
251f623e8e (Finsert_file_contents): Pass del_range_1 two ends, not a length. 1994-03-04 04:19:14 +00:00
Richard M. Stallman
8a5dd08600 (byte-compile-insert-header): Take a filename argument.
(byte-compile-from-buffer): Change second argument to filename.
Always return outbuffer; never eval from it or kill it.
(byte-compile-file): Pass filename to byte-compile-from-buffer.
1994-03-04 04:03:46 +00:00
Richard M. Stallman
17b85a9b30 (ange-ftp-nslookup-host, ange-ftp-start-process):
Bind default-directory to some accessible directory, if necessary.
1994-03-04 01:33:43 +00:00
Karl Heuer
b28e2cc6b0 (chan_process): Don't specify size. 1994-03-04 01:08:34 +00:00
Karl Heuer
176afd0492 (c-fill-paragraph): Preserve final sentence boundary. 1994-03-04 00:05:15 +00:00
Richard M. Stallman
ba02c1673c Rename comint-input-filter-functions and
comint-output-filter-functions.

(shell-mode): Put dir tracker on comint-input-filter-functions,
not ...output...

(shell-directory-tracker, shell-process-popd):
Call just error, not message and error.
1994-03-03 23:57:27 +00:00
Richard M. Stallman
8a16a82695 (inferior-scheme-mode): Removed unnecessary
initialisation of comint-input-sentinel.
1994-03-03 23:56:04 +00:00
Richard M. Stallman
fb9ab28af0 (comint-input-filter-functions)
(comint-output-filter-functions):
Renamed from ...-sentinel-functions.
1994-03-03 23:53:46 +00:00
Richard M. Stallman
988a4d60ce (shell-dynamic-complete-functions): New variable.
(shell-mode): Use it to set comint-dynamic-complete-functions.

(shell-mode-map): Define menu-bars for command,
variable and directory completion/expansion.

(shell-get-current-command, shell-after-partial-filename): Functions deleted.

(shell-dynamic-complete-environment-variable,
shell-replace-by-expanded-directory): New commands.
(shell-match-partial-variable,
shell-dynamic-complete-as-environment-variable): New functions.
1994-03-03 23:37:27 +00:00
Richard M. Stallman
1b4218268d (comint-after-partial-filename-command,
comint-dynamic-complete-filename-command,
comint-dynamic-complete-command-command,
comint-get-current-command): Deleted.

(comint-input-sentinel-functions): Replaces comint-input-sentinel.
(comint-input-sentinel): Deleted.
(comint-send-input): Run hooks on comint-input-sentinel-functions.
(comint-output-sentinel-functions): Rename from comint-output-filter-functions.

(comint-dynamic-complete-functions): New variable.

(comint-mode-map): Removed menu-bar for command and variable completion.

(comint-exec-1): Add to environment by hand; avoids using setenv.

(comint-replace-by-expanded-history-before-point):
Renamed from comint-replace-by-expanded-history.
(comint-replace-by-expanded-history): New wrapper definition.

(comint-word): New function.
(comint-match-partial-filename): Use it.
(comint-after-partial-filename, comint-match-partial-variable,
comint-dynamic-complete-variable): Deleted.

(comint-dynamic-complete): Run hooks on comint-dynamic-complete-functions.

(comint-dynamic-complete-as-filename): Renamed from
function comint-dynamic-complete-filename.
(comint-dynamic-complete-filename): New wrapper definition.

(comint-dynamic-simple-complete): Return a symbol representing completion.
1994-03-03 23:30:57 +00:00
Roland McGrath
52859db83c (generate-file-autoloads): Move misplaced paren in match clause of cond
so copying the rest of the line to the output is the else clause of if
(eolp), not after the if.
1994-03-03 22:13:45 +00:00
Karl Heuer
74cc295951 Fix typo in comment. 1994-03-03 21:28:36 +00:00
Karl Heuer
e5ccf0c17e (server-switch-buffer): Don't select a minibuffer. 1994-03-03 21:13:08 +00:00
Karl Heuer
351bd676ba (Fread_file_name): Do the right thing when insert-default-directory is nil.
Allow for doubled dollar signs in dir when computing pos.
1994-03-03 21:01:37 +00:00
Karl Heuer
4e665715b9 (record_delete): Save last_point_position in the undo record, rather than the
current value of point.
1994-03-03 20:12:01 +00:00
Karl Heuer
01314b95fa New variable last_point_position. 1994-03-03 20:08:49 +00:00
Karl Heuer
b453f72e5c (command_loop_1): Set last_point_position to the value of point. 1994-03-03 20:08:12 +00:00